    Wow, here is my list:

    Infant Baptism (Christened) into the Episcopal Church.

    Confirmed into the Lutheran Church at 25

    Tried to be a Seventh-Day Adventist(because that was what hubby was at one time), but they wouldnt take me

    Then we joined a half-way Church for X-SDA, and it was there that I was really Baptised...!!

    Then that Church folded (how can you be X-anything??) and I started looking around for what to be next..

    I checked out a bunch of books at the Library and read up on all the denominations. That is how I figured out I should be a Baptist.

    A friend found a good Baptist Church, I joined and have been Baptist ever since!!
